Rhoda Kalema obituary

15 septembre 2025 | Peter Woodsford
My friend Rhoda Kalema, a politician and women’s rights activist, who has died aged 96, was known as the “mother of Uganda’s parliament”. When her husband, William, a minister in the government of Milton Obote, Uganda’s first post-independence leader, was murdered by Idi Amin’s thugs in 1972, (…)
